Title :
A hybrid learning system proposal for PLC wiring training using AR

Abstract :
With rapid developments in the manufacturing industry, there has been increasing attention on PLC training for implementing factory automation. In order to meet the increasing demand for PLC training, this paper proposes a PLC wiring training system using AR. The proposed training system is a hybrid learning system for technology education, dedicated to wiring practice, the input part of PLC. Cases for wiring practices are studied and categorized as three groups for the implementation. The system implemented for PLC training is presented and some trainings are given using it.
